diff options
Diffstat (limited to 'poppler/TextOutputDev.cc')
-rw-r--r-- | poppler/TextOutputDev.cc |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/poppler/TextOutputDev.cc b/poppler/TextOutputDev.cc index 23e0a7ae..4a37b29f 100644 --- a/poppler/TextOutputDev.cc +++ b/poppler/TextOutputDev.cc @@ -4146,6 +4146,12 @@ bool TextPage::findText(const Unicode *s, int len, bool startAtTop, bool stopAtB continueMatch->x2 = xMax2; continueMatch->y2 = yMin2; } + } else if (continueMatch && continueMatch->x1 != std::numeric_limits<double>::max()) { + if (ignoredHyphen) { + *ignoredHyphen = false; + } + + continueMatch->x1 = std::numeric_limits<double>::max(); } } } |